Skills measured

AWS Architecture Design and Deployment

The ability to design and deploy scalable, fault-tolerant systems on AWS is crucial for any AWS Cloud Engineer. This sub-skill assesses the candidate's proficiency in designing and implementing complex architectures on AWS. It involves evaluating their knowledge of AWS services, their ability to select the right service for a specific use case, and their understanding of best practices for designing and deploying fault-tolerant and scalable systems.

AWS Security and Compliance

AWS Security and Compliance is a critical sub-skill that assesses the candidate's knowledge of AWS security standards and their ability to implement security best practices on AWS. This sub-skill evaluates the candidate's ability to design and implement secure AWS environments that adhere to various compliance requirements and industry best practices.

AWS Networking

This sub-skill assesses the candidate's understanding of AWS networking concepts such as VPCs, subnets, routing tables, and security groups. It evaluates their proficiency in designing and implementing complex networking architectures on AWS and their ability to troubleshoot networking issues.

AWS Storage and Database

This sub-skill evaluates the candidate's proficiency in using AWS storage and database services such as S3, EBS, RDS, and DynamoDB. It assesses their knowledge of how to select and configure the right storage or database service for a specific use case.

AWS Compute

AWS Compute is another critical sub-skill that assesses the candidate's proficiency in using AWS compute services such as EC2, Lambda, and Elastic Beanstalk. This sub-skill evaluates their ability to deploy and manage compute resources on AWS efficiently.

Automation and Orchestration

Automation and Orchestration is an essential sub-skill that evaluates the candidate's proficiency in automating various AWS services' deployment and management. This sub-skill assesses their ability to create and manage infrastructure as code, use configuration management tools such as Chef or Puppet, and automate tasks using AWS services like CloudFormation and Lambda.

Use of the AWS Cloud Engineer Test

The AWS Cloud Engineer test is designed to assess a candidate’s knowledge and proficiency in various aspects of AWS cloud infrastructure and services. This test evaluates the candidate’s ability to design, deploy, and manage scalable, fault-tolerant systems on AWS. It also tests the candidate’s understanding of key AWS concepts, such as security, networking, storage, and compute.

Assessing a candidate’s proficiency in AWS cloud infrastructure and services is crucial when hiring for AWS Cloud Engineer roles. AWS Cloud Engineers are responsible for designing, deploying, and managing AWS infrastructure for various business needs. These roles require expertise in multiple AWS services and strong problem-solving skills to address issues that may arise while working on the cloud.

Candidates who clear this test are proficient in AWS cloud infrastructure and services, possess strong analytical skills, and can efficiently manage AWS infrastructure to achieve business goals. The test helps recruiters identify the most skilled and knowledgeable candidates, leading to better hiring decisions and the creation of a highly efficient AWS infrastructure for the company.

Who is this test for?

The AWS Cloud Engineer test is relevant for individuals who are seeking to demonstrate their expertise in designing, deploying, and managing applications on the AWS platform. This test is typically taken by cloud architects, developers, and IT professionals who work with AWS and want to validate their skills and knowledge. The test covers a wide range of topics related to AWS services, architecture, security, and best practices, and is designed to ensure that candidates have a thorough understanding of the AWS ecosystem.
